3. Setting up a Local Server (EaglercraftX Server)

To play "188 New," you generally needed a compatible server. The standard Vanilla 1.8.8 server jar could not communicate with the browser directly.

The "Bungee" Method: Eaglercraft requires a proxy to translate the Websocket connection from the browser to the TCP connection used by standard Minecraft servers.

  1. Java Runtime: Ensure you have Java 17 or newer installed.
  2. EaglercraftBungee: You need the specific BungeeCord jar designed for Eaglercraft (often named EaglercraftBungee-1.8.8.jar).
  3. Server Jar: You need a standard Minecraft 1.8.8 server jar (like paper-1.8.8.jar or spigot-1.8.8.jar).
  4. Configuration:
    • You configure the config.yml in the Bungee jar to point to your local Minecraft server (usually 127.0.0.1:25565).
    • You configure the listener to accept Websocket connections (often on port 8081).
  5. Connecting: In the Eagler 188 client, you would type ws://127.0.0.1:8081 to join your own game.
